PresencePulse 🟢

PresencePulse is a lightweight GNOME desktop app that keeps your Microsoft Teams status active by launching a dedicated Chromium session and simulating periodic activity. Designed for Linux environments (especially NixOS), it avoids synthetic input detection and integrates cleanly with your desktop.


🚀 Features

  • Launches Chromium in app mode with a clean, minimal UI
  • Uses a dedicated browser profile for isolation and persistence
  • Periodically injects mousemove events to prevent idle status
  • Configurable window size, and position

Development Environment

The project uses flake.nix and .envrc to configure and manage the development environment.


🧰 Requirements

  • Linux (tested on NixOS, should work on most distros)
  • chromium executable in $PATH
